For more than 60 years, Accounting for Governmental & Nonprofit
Entities has led the market in governmental accounting. It is a
comprehensive government and not-for-profit accounting text,
written for students who will be auditing and working in public and
not-for-profit sector entities. Originally published in 1951 and
written by Professor R. M. Mikesell, this book and the many
subsequent editions revised by Professors Leon Hay, Earl Wilson,
Susan Kattelus, Jacqueline Reck, Suzanne Lowensohn, and Daniel
Neely have given generations of instructors and students a
comprehensive knowledge of the specialized accounting and financial
reporting practices of government and not-for-profit organizations,
as well as an understanding of how those organizations can better
meet the information needs of a diverse set of financial statement
users and decision makers. The vision of the early authors
continues to be reflected in this 19th edition, and their strategy
of providing a large and innovative set of instructional support
materials prepared and tested in the classroom by the authors
continues to be a guiding principle today. The current author team
brings to this edition their extensive experience teaching
government and not-for-profit courses as well as insights gained
from their professional experience, scholarly writing, and
professional activities. The result is a relevant and accurate text
that includes the most effective instructional tools.
